Spanish Roja Garlic

Mid-season, Rocambole type. Probably the most popular hardneck type because most garlic lovers find the flavor to be “true garlic”. A Northwest heirloom that was reported to have been brought into Northwest Oregon before 1900, it is often called Greek garlic by home gardeners throughout the region.
